Golden Points had a distinctive 21 foot tall golden tower. Golden Point was founded in 1958 and had its headquarters in Chicago, IL. There were at least eight Golden Points in the Chicago area, as well as various cities in FL, Wilmington, DE and Washington, DC. Gibson's was based in Bethesda, MD and by 1963, they had locations in Wilmington, Baltimore, Richmond, Norfolk, Roanoke and Washington, DC. There was a Golden Point in Flint, MI but the building was demolished. I don't know if or how Golden Point and Gibson's were related to each other but their building styles were very similar. This Orlando Golden Point is now Station 441, a bar and check cashing place. It was still a Golden Point until at least 1970. For more, see this website.

This Hampton Golden Point now houses Arnell's Barber & Hair Styling. While records indicate that this was a Gibson's at one time, clearly the steeple shows that this must have been a Golden Point as well. I don't know which restaurant occupied the building first. This building was moved a few hundred yards back from its original site on Mercury Blvd.

This Warren Golden Point has been converted into the Mayfair Laundromat which is now part of a strip mall. The sign still retains the original shape (and name somewhat).

This Brooklyn Golden Point was built in the 1960s. It housed "PDQ Hamburgers" from 1965-1975. Today, it is occupied by "Pat's Brooklyn Cleaners".

This Grand Island Golden Point was home to Randy's Auto Sales, a used car dealer, when these photos were taken. It was one of the most intact Golden Points that I have seen. It even had what appeared to be the original blue canopy in front of the building. In 2006, there was talk of demolishing the building for road widening. Sure enough, in 2008, it was gone and Randy's had a new building. For more, see this website.

The former Beloit Golden Point was built in 1958 and was one of the earliest locations built. The building is very well preserved but now goes by the name of Nick's Circus Drive-in. I don't know if the double canopy was original.
